Chris Brown's "Graffiti" Album Moved Up

Chris Brown must feel like his fans will stand behind him strong, as he pushed his album up a whole week.

Brown, who was set to release Graffiti December 15th, 2009 in time for the holidays, has now bumped the disc up to December 8th, 2009. His third album will face less competition than if he had released it the 15th, now only going up against Timbaland, Gucci Mane and Snoop Dogg.

He revealed the news vis his Twitter account yesterday saying, "Good NEWS: my album date has changed.. December 8. Graffiti. If u love me get it twice and if u hate me still get it,". Wow, seems like he really cares about the fans of his who were hurt after his actions with Rihanna.

His latest single "I Can Transform Ya", which features Lil' Wayne and Swizz Beatz is only number 24 on the Billboard 100, but I guess that's enough for his label to give him the thumbs up.
